#include "pw_uart/uart.h"
#include "gtest/gtest.h"
#include "pw_status/status.h"
#include "pw_status/status_with_size.h"
namespace pw::uart {
namespace {
class UartStub : public Uart {
public:
UartStub() {}
~UartStub() override = default;
private:
Status DoEnable(bool) override { return OkStatus(); }
StatusWithSize DoTryReadFor(
ByteSpan, std::optional<chrono::SystemClock::duration>) override {
return StatusWithSize(0);
}
StatusWithSize DoTryWriteFor(
ConstByteSpan, std::optional<chrono::SystemClock::duration>) override {
return StatusWithSize(0);
}
Status DoSetBaudRate(uint32_t) override { return OkStatus(); }
size_t DoConservativeReadAvailable() override { return 0; }
Status DoFlushOutput() override { return OkStatus(); }
Status DoClearPendingReceiveBytes() override { return OkStatus(); }
};
class UartTest : public ::testing::Test {
public:
UartTest() : stub_() {}
private:
UartStub stub_;
};
TEST_F(UartTest, CompilationSucceeds) { EXPECT_TRUE(true); }
} // namespace
} // namespace pw::uart
